BELGIAN CLAIM
! AGAINST FRENCH FUNDS IN U.S.A. ON ACCOUNT OF GOLD SENT TO DAKAR. ATTACHMENT WRIT OBTAINED, ißy Telegraph—Press Association—Copyright! (Received This Dav. 12.15 p.m.t NEW YORK. February G. The exiled Belgian Government has obtained an attachment writ against 2G0,fi00.00() dollars of Bank of France funds in the United States. The Belgians claim that ihe National Bunk of Belgium handed over to the Bank of France 200.000.000 worth of gold for safe keeping during the invasion of Belgium, but the Bank of France, despite Belgian opposition, sent the gold to Dakar, from whence (he Fi'epch are now taking the gold to Purls, for delivery to the Germans. The Belgium Ambassador. M. Thrums. stated that France, if she persists. will be forced to replace every ounce of the gold handed over to the Germans,
